I generally enjoy fiddling around with my toys anyway, so doing a little maintenance here and there will not be an issue. In doing my research, it appears that a lot of the smaller "Japanese" bikes have China-built engines anyway and many are assembled in Thailand. So much for "made in Japan". My Suzuki TU250 claims to be built in Japan but it sounds like the engine was made by Jinan Qingqi in China, so it seems that I already own a Chinese motorcycle and didn't even know it.
